A few compatibility notes worth flagging: AAX support (required for Pro Tools) is standard on ToneLab and most major commercial bundles, but boutique suites sometimes ship VST3/AU only, so confirm before buying if Pro Tools is your primary DAW. Open-source environments like Overtone run as standalone or integrated via SuperCollider, not as traditional DAW plugins, so they sit outside the VST3/AU/AAX ecosystem entirely. CPU load varies widely across commercial bundles depending on how many instances you run simultaneously; check vendor system requirements against your session complexity.

Open-source programmable environments (Overtone)

Overtone is an open-source toolkit for programmable synthesis and live coding, built on a Clojure API over the SuperCollider engine. It supports MIDI I/O, OSC, and a growing library of musical functions. It is not a DAW plugin in the VST3/AU/AAX sense; it runs as a standalone environment or integrates via SuperCollider. That distinction matters if your workflow centers on a traditional DAW.
Strengths:
- Full programmability; build any synthesis or processing structure you can code
- Free and open source, cross-platform (Windows, macOS, Linux)
- Active community and extensive documentation
Weaknesses:
- No VST3/AU/AAX integration; does not drop into a standard DAW session
- Requires Clojure/programming knowledge to use effectively
- Not suited for real-time mixing or mastering in a conventional session
Best for: Composers, researchers, and sound designers comfortable with live coding who want maximum flexibility outside a traditional DAW environment.
How do you pick the right alternative for your setup?
Start with your DAW and format requirements, because everything else is secondary if the plugin does not load.
Must-verify compatibility checklist:
- Plugin format: Does your DAW require VST3, AU, or AAX? Pro Tools demands AAX. Logic Pro uses AU. Most others support VST3.
- OS version: Confirm the plugin supports your current Windows or macOS version, not just the latest release.
- Sample rate support: Verify the plugin handles your session's sample rate (44.1 kHz, 48 kHz, 88.2 kHz, 96 kHz).
- CPU load: Check vendor system requirements against your CPU and typical session track count.
- Plugin window sizing: HiDPI/Retina scaling support matters on modern displays; blurry UIs slow down workflow.
- Offline vs. real-time processing: Some mastering tools process offline only; confirm this fits your workflow.
